Review The International Statistical Classification of Diseases and Health Related Problems: ICD-10, Three Volume Set (Nonserial Publications) / World Health Organization:

This new edition of WHO's International Classification of Diseases, 10th Revision (ICD-10) has been fully updated for the second time. Originally published in the early 1990s, ICD-10 now incorporates all edits and updates since 1996 up to the end of 2008. In addition, the numbering system has changed and now clearly indicates the year that the updates were incorporated. In 2000, WHO formed an international panel to review and collate all adjustments to the ICD-10 proposed by many institutions around the world. Panel members consult several times a year and this definitive 2008 edition of ICD-10 is the result of their work. Fifteen years of daily international use of the classification have resulted in many improvements, and these have been incorporated into Volume 1: the index, rules and guidelines. As a result, the classification is now easier to use and implement, accomodates new scientific knowledge, makes it easier to understand health statistics and improves comparability of international mortality statistics. The thousands of changes that have been introduced are based on about 400 recommendations for Volume 1, 90 recommendations for Volume 2, and more than 700 recommendations for Volume 3. They are the product of a continuous international collaboration. The ICD is the international standard diagnostic classification for all general epidemiological purposes, many health management purposes and clinical use. [+]
These include analysis of the general health situation of population groups and monitoring the incidence and prevalence of diseases, as well as other health problems with respect to variables such as the characteristics and circumstances of the individuals affected, reimbursement, case-mix, resource allocation, quality, patient safety, and guidelines. ICD is used for health information purposes in public health, primary, secondary and tertiary care settings. In particular, it is used to classify diseases, accidents, reasons for encounter, and other health problems recorded on many types of health and vital records including death certificates and health records. In addition to facilitating the storage and retrieval of diagnostic information for clinical, epidemiological and quality purposes, the resulting records form the basis for compiling national mortality and morbidity statistics by WHO Member States. ICD serves a language-independent framework for classification of diseases and has been translated into more than 40 languages. Included in this set:Volume 1: Tabular List, 1200 ppVolume 2: Instruction Manual, 190 ppVolume 3, Alphabetical Index, 900 pp.

Review Dictionary of Steroids / Chapman & Hall/CRC:

Steroids are a significant class of compound which occupy a central role in science today. Their wide range of biological activity has led to a large number of steroids finding clinical use as anticancer drugs, anti-inflammatory agents, contraceptives, diuretics and cardioactive agents. This reference is a compilation of chemical, structural and bibliographic data on the most interesting and important steroids known. It should prove useful to chemists working in this field. Bound in two volumes, this dictionary presents physical and chemical data, biological source and medicinal uses of over 15,000 steroids in 6,500 entries. Documentation is comprehensive for natural steroids (human, plant and animal), for example bile acids, sterols and steroidal alkaloids. Coverage is given of synthetic and semi-synthetic steroids including those of medicinal interest and those used as starting materials in synthesis. Every entry is given its systematic name and a trivial name where appropriate. Bibliographic data for each entry has been labelled to indicate content. The current literature has been reviewed until September 1990 and while a small proportion of entries have come from the "Dictionary of Organic Compounds" these have been enlarged and updated; the majority are new with coverage of natural products. [+]
The indexes, which are bound in a separate volume for convenience, include Name, Molecular Formula, Type of Compound, CAS Registry Number and species. In the Type of Compound Index entries are arranged according to steroid ring structure or biological activity (for example pregnanes and andostranes) thus allowing steroids of a particular type to be easily found and compared. The Species index allows rapid access to the data using the botanical or zoological name. This book should be a useful reference source for steroid biochemists, natural product chemists, bile acid researchers, and medicinal and pharmaceutical chemists.

Review Phytochemical Dictionary: A Handbook of Bioactive Compounds from Plants, Second Edition / CRC:

This perennially bestselling dictionary provides nutritionists, food scientists, and researchers with access to routinely needed information, including structural formulae, on plant constituents. It profiles over 3000 substances from phenolics and alkaloids through carbohydrates and plant glycosides to oils and triterpenoids. For each substance, the editors present its trivial name, synonyms, structural type, chemical structure showing stereochemistry, molecular weight and formula, as well as its natural occurrence, biological activity and both its common and commercial uses. Key references are provided for each class and subclass.

Review Encyclopedia of Medical Decision Making: Two-Volume Set / Sage Publications, Inc:

Decision making is a critical element in the field of medicine that can lead to life-or-death outcomes, yet it is an element fraught with complex and conflicting variables, diagnostic and therapeutic uncertainties, patient preferences and values, and costs. Together, decisions made by physicians, patients, insurers, and policymakers determine the quality of health care, quality that depends inherently on counterbalancing risks and benefits and competing objectives such as maximizing life expectancy versus optimizing quality of life or quality of care versus economic realities. Broadly speaking, concepts in medical decision making (MDM) may be divided into two major categories: prescriptive and descriptive. Work in the area of prescriptive MDM investigates how medical decisions should be done using complicated analyses and algorithms to determine cost-effectiveness measures, prediction methods, and so on. In contrast, descriptive MDM studies how decisions actually are made involving human judgment, biases, social influences, patient factors, and so on. The Encyclopedia of Medical Decision Making gives a gentle introduction to both categories, revealing how medical and healthcare decisions are actually made-and constrained-and how physician, healthcare management, and patient decision making can be improved to optimize health outcomes. Key FeaturesDiscusses very general issues that span many aspects of MDM, including bioethics; health policy and economics; disaster simulation modeling; medical informatics; the psychology of decision making; shared and team medical decision making; social, moral, and religious factors; end-of-life decision making; assessing patient preference and patient adherence; and moreIncorporates both quantity and quality of life in optimizing a medical decisionConsiders characteristics of the decisionmaker and how those characteristics influence their decisionsPresents outcome measures to judge the quality or impact of a medical decisionExamines some of the more commonly encountered biostatistical methods used in prescriptive decision makingProvides utility assessment techniques that facilitate quantitative medical decision makingAddresses the many different assumption perspectives the decision maker might choose from when trying to optimize a decisionOffers mechanisms for defining MDM algorithmsWith comprehensive and authoritative coverage by experts in the fields of medicine, decision science and cognitive psychology, and healthcare management, this two-volume Encyclopedia is a must-have resource for any academic library.

Review Elsevier's Dictionary of Medicine and Biology: in English, Greek, German, Italian and Latin / Elsevier Science:

Dictionaries are didactic books used as consultation instruments for self-teaching. They are composed by an ordered set of linguistic units which reflects a double structure, the macrostructure which correspond to the word list and the microstructure that refers to the contents of each lemma. The great value of dictionaries nests in the fact that they establish a standard nomenclature and prevent in that way the appearance of new useless synonyms. This dictionary contains a total of about 27. 500 main English entries, and over of 130. 000 translations that should normally sufficiently cover all fields of life sciences. The basic criteria used to accept a word a part of the dictionary during the development period in order of importance were usage, up-to-dateness, specificity, simplicity and conceptual relationships. The dictionary meets the standards of higher education and covers all main fields of life sciences by setting its primary focus on the vastly developing fields of cell biology, biochemistry, molecular biology, immunology, developmental biology, microbiology, genetics and also the fields of human anatomy, histology, pathology, physiology, zoology and botany. The fields of ecology, paleontology, systematics, evolution, biostatistics, plant physiology, plant anatomy, plant histology, biometry and lab techniques have been sufficiently covered but in a more general manner. The latest Latin international anatomical terminology "Terminologia Anatomica" or "TA" has been fully incorporated and all anatomical entries have been given their international Latin TA synonym. [+]
This dictionary will be a valuable and helpful tool for all scientists, teachers, students and generally all those that work within the fields of life sciences.
